  • “The Bet” is the story of a bet that stakes a banker’s two million rubles against fifteen years of a young lawyer’s life.

      I think what happened is that the opinions of both the lawyer(prisoner) and the banker(old man) changed completely. The lawyer used to argue that life in prison is better than death penalty, but now he believes that life and its blessings are "worthless, fleeting, illusory, and deceptive." He also renounced the two million for which he put his freedom at stake years ago.
      The banker, who used to believe that life imprisonment was inhumane and even more immoral than death penalty now believes that it is a great deal better and more humane than death penalty. He saw the lawyer transform into a highly intellectual and spiritual person during the lawyer's solitary imprisonment. In the end, when the banker read the prisoner's note which censured humans for their avarice and wrong priorities, he felt so much respect for the prisoner that he "kissed the [prisoner] on the head" and "felt [a] great contempt for himself" because he was one of the people who were controlled by their avarice for the fleeting and deceptive matererialistic things of the world. He considered the prisoner and his priorities superior to the regular humans and understood that life, no matter in what circumstances, is better than no life. Life gives you a chance to grow and transform yourself, while death puts a stop to your story.
      I think the other way to look at this is that as time passed, both men became a little unsure about their opinions. That's because the were naive and unexperienced when they made the bet, and hence had very strong opinions. Later, with experience, they learned that reality was a mix of both of their opinions.

      He is alive and escaped. The banker went to kill the lawyer because he was going to go bankrupt from bad investments and frivolous spending of money. Indeed, realizing that the fifteen years is almost up, the bankers plan was to murder the attorney and frame the guard. However, the guard is gone and when the banker sneaks up on the lawyer, he finds him sound asleep. Just as he is about to kill the him, the banker finds a note that explains that through his reading of books during time in isolation, the lawyer has come to completely reject the material world he once loved. It turns out he's planning on forfeiting the bet on purpose by leaving five hours early. The banker kisses the lawyer's head, cries, and leaves. The next day, the guards report that the lawyer bailed early. The banker takes the letter and puts it into his safety box.
